Understanding MOT Defect Categories
Dangerous
Direct and immediate risk to road safety or the environment. Vehicle must not be driven until repaired.
Major
May affect safety, environment, or other road users. Repair immediately.
Minor
No significant effect on safety but should be repaired as soon as possible.
Advisory
Could become more serious in the future. Monitor and repair if necessary.
